A genuinely scarce and technically interesting vintage front derailleur.
This Simplex SGDG front derailleur features the rare bottom pull configuration combined with telescopic actuation, a design detail that set Simplex apart during the golden era of French component innovation.
Built for classic road setups, this derailleur is increasingly difficult to source — particularly in complete, functional condition. A strong choice for period-correct restorations, historically accurate builds, or collectors seeking distinctive mechanical solutions from mid-century cycling design.
